...MOREDuring the North American International Auto Show, (NAIAS) one of the most important announcements I heard was made by GM Chairman Rick Wagoner, who announced a partnership with Coskata, a Warrensville, IL, biology-based ethanol producer. ...MOREDuring the keynote address at CES, GM Chairman Rick Wagoner unveiled the company’s newest fuel-cell concept vehicle on the E-Flex platform and the first vehicle introduction ever at CES, the Cadillac Provoq.
